Nelagoney is an unincorporated community and census-designated place (CDP) in Osage County, Oklahoma, United States. It was first listed as a CDP prior to the 2020 census.[2]

The CDP is in eastern Osage County, on a hill overlooking Bird Creek to the north. The west border of the CDP follows Saucy Calf Creek, a north-flowing tributary of Bird Creek, which flows southeast to the Verdigris River northeast of Tulsa.
Nelagoney is 6 miles (10 km) southeast of Pawhuska, the Osage county seat, 22 miles (35 km) southwest of Bartlesville, and 45 miles (72 km) north-northwest of Tulsa.
